home *** CD-ROM | disk | FTP | other *** search
/ Magnum One / Magnum One (Mid-American Digital) (Disc Manufacturing).iso / d3 / bakerdoz.arc / READ.ME < prev    next >
Text File  |  1989-02-05  |  14KB  |  408 lines

  1.  
  2.        +------------------------------------------------------+
  3.        |  Welcome to "User Supported Software" (Shareware).   |
  4.        |  This remarkable revolution in software distribution |
  5.        |  was  co-pioneered in 1982 by Jim Button and  Andrew |
  6.        |  Fluegelman.  It  has  become a  major  force in the |
  7.        |  software industry, helping to drive software prices |
  8.        |  down and eliminate copy protection schemes.         |
  9.        +------------------------------------------------------+
  10.             Member, Association of Shareware Professionals
  11.  
  12.  
  13.                     HERE'S HOW SHAREWARE WORKS:
  14.  
  15. You are encouraged to copy the PC-File+ diskettes and share them freely with
  16. others.  You have the luxury of trying out the complete programs, at your
  17. own pace and in the comfort of your own home or workplace.  This is not a
  18. crippled or "demo" copy, but the complete working version of the program.
  19.  
  20. If, after trying out the programs, you decide to continue to use them, you
  21. are trusted to purchase PC-File+ from the program's author, or from an
  22. authorized dealer.  Your support is important and greatly appreciated.
  23. With it, Shareware authors are encouraged to design and distribute new
  24. products.  Without it, a great deal of high quality, low cost software will
  25. cease to be available.
  26.  
  27.  
  28. Why pay at all?
  29. --------------------------------------------------------------
  30.    *  You receive a CURRENT copy of the program
  31.    *  You receive a printed manual (250 pages)
  32.    *  One year of technical support - by phone or written
  33.    *  Notification of updates
  34.    *  Inexpensive upgrade offers
  35.    *  Notification of new products
  36.    *  Periodic offers and "deals" (for our customers only)
  37.    *  Your input and ideas help shape future products
  38.    *  Access to the on-line ButtonWare Bulletin Board, which means:
  39.         - Information and announcements (on line)
  40.         - Communication with other ButtonWare users
  41.         - More technical support, and helpful tips/pointers
  42.    *  A sense of pride and ownership, in having honestly
  43.       participated in the Shareware revolution
  44.    *  You help to keep software prices down, by supporting a
  45.       distribution method which doesn't rely on expensive
  46.       advertising campaigns.
  47.  
  48. I hope my product becomes a useful and productive tool for you, and I urge
  49. you to consider other Shareware products when you decide to add software to
  50. your system.
  51. So please dive in and enjoy the fun of legally sharing good software with
  52. your friends and associates.  But also be aware of the following
  53. restrictions, designed to protect the community of Shareware users and
  54. authors, and to prevent greedy people from taking unfair advantage of the
  55. trust, hard work, and good will of Shareware authors:
  56.  
  57. 1. No price or other consideration may be charged. However, a distribution
  58.    cost may be charged for the cost of the diskettes, shipping, and
  59.    handling, not to exceed $3 total (equivalent U.S. dollars).
  60.    Exceptions must be obtained in writing from ButtonWare.
  61.  
  62. 2. The files and programs on the disks may not be modified nor deleted.
  63.  
  64. 3. The programs cannot be sold as part of some other more inclusive package.
  65.  
  66. 4. The programs cannot be "rented" or "leased" to others.
  67.  
  68. 5. The printed manual cannot be copied or reproduced in any way.
  69.  
  70. 6. In the case of distribution via computerized "bulletin boards" or through
  71.    any other telecommunications link the following must be done:
  72.     *  X-Modem or some other error checking protocol must be used
  73.     *  All ButtonWare programs (and documentation files) must be transferred
  74.        in a library format.  That means the files have all been combined
  75.        into one file.  You can get assistance with this procedure from the
  76.        Technical Support Department at ButtonWare.
  77.  
  78. 7. If you're copying the disks for distribution to students in a classroom,
  79.    you must provide them with the following written notice:
  80.  
  81.       +-----------------------------------------------------+
  82.       | These diskettes are distributed to you through the  |
  83.       | courtesy of (your school or instructor name), and   |
  84.       | Jim Button.  No royalty or registration fee has     |
  85.       | been paid for the programs, which are for your use  |
  86.       | and evaluation as a student.                        |
  87.       |                                                     |
  88.       | If you wish to receive technical support from       |
  89.       | ButtonWare, as well as announcements of updates and |
  90.       | improvements to the programs, you must first become |
  91.       | a "registered user."  You do that by purchasing     |
  92.       | each program you plan to use - from an authorized   |
  93.       | dealer or directly from ButtonWare:                 |
  94.       |                                                     |
  95.       |                    Jim Button                       |
  96.       |                  P.O.  Box 96058                    |
  97.       |              Bellevue, WA 98009-4469                |
  98.       |                                                     |
  99.       | You may also purchase by calling the toll-free      |
  100.       | ButtonWare order line, 1-800-JBUTTON.               |
  101.       +-----------------------------------------------------+
  102.  
  103. 8. PC-File+ may not be copied or shared outside of the United States,
  104.    Canada, and England.  We believe that most foreign users are best served
  105.    by their own publishers who sell licensed versions of PC-File+.
  106.                  INSTRUCTIONS FOR USING BAKER'S DOZEN
  107.  
  108.  
  109. DOZEN.BAT
  110. ---------
  111. Shell to run Baker's Dozen programs, intended to help you get
  112. started.  Runs BAKERS12.EXE using file DOZEN.TBL.  Normally you
  113. should run Baker's Dozen programs by themselves.
  114.  
  115. To start:
  116. C>dozen
  117.  
  118. Select options.  When finished, press X or Esc.
  119.  
  120.  
  121. BTTNCALC.EXE
  122. ------------
  123. One page spreadsheet, help screens.  Requires 256K,
  124. full IBM PC compatability.
  125.  
  126. To start:
  127. C>bttncalc f=m b=n filespec
  128.  
  129. where: m = foreground color (0,1,...9,A,...F)
  130.        n = background color (0,1,...7)
  131. filespec = full filespec of a previously saved
  132.          BUTTON-CALC file.
  133.  
  134. NOTE: no parameters needed.  Defaults to current
  135.       screen colors.  Previously saved files may be
  136.       loaded within BUTTON-CALC.
  137.  
  138.  
  139. CALENDAR.COM
  140. ------------
  141. Programmable calendar.  Uses 9K with all data
  142. in CAL.DAT.  May be made resident with the r=Y option.
  143.  
  144. To make resident:
  145. C>calendar i=cal.dat r=Y f=F b=4 h=E m="message" k=6400
  146.  
  147. where:
  148.    i= full filespec of input data file
  149.    r= Y to make resident
  150.    f= foreground color in hex
  151.    b= background color in hex
  152.    h= highlight color in hex
  153.    m= message to display inside
  154.    k= hot key (scancode plus character in hex)
  155.  
  156.    defaults: not resident
  157.              white on blue with red highlighting
  158.              no message
  159.              Alt7 hot key
  160.              no calendar data.
  161.  
  162. C>calendar i=cal.dat r=Y  (normal way to make resident)
  163. DISKUTIL.EXE
  164. ------------
  165. Disk utility program.  Requires at least 256K and full
  166. IBM PC compatability.
  167.  
  168. No input parameters.
  169. Numerous help screens (press F1 at almost any time).
  170. Change file or directory date/time, restore lost file,
  171. patch files, modify FAT, and much more.
  172.  
  173. To start:
  174. C>diskutil
  175.  
  176.  
  177. FILECOMP.EXE
  178. ------------
  179. Compare two ASCII text files.  Size of files limited to
  180. available memory.
  181.  
  182. C>filecomp
  183. will present program instructions.
  184.  
  185. To start:
  186. C>filecomp pathspec1 pathspec2 u=x  m=x b=x >redirspec
  187.  
  188. where:
  189.    pathspec1 first of two files to compare
  190.    pathspec2 second of two files to compare
  191.    u=n display unique line numbers
  192.    u=l display unique lines
  193.    m=n display map of matching line numbers
  194.    m=l display map of matching lines
  195.    b=x remove all spaces
  196.    >redirspec where to save output if not screen.
  197.  
  198. minimum parameters to run:
  199. C>filecomp pathspec1 pathspec2
  200.  
  201.  
  202. GKEY.EXE
  203. --------
  204. Provides keyboard information - key number pressed
  205. or released, hexadecimal and decimal table of ASCII
  206. character set, scancodes and valid keystrokes.  No
  207. parameters.
  208.  
  209. To start:
  210. C>gkey
  211. LOCATE.EXE
  212. ----------
  213. Find any file(s) on disk or find in which file(s) a
  214. given string occurs.
  215.  
  216. To start:
  217. C>locate
  218. will present a screen of instructions.
  219.  
  220. or:
  221. C>locate filespec string /c /i /t >output
  222.  
  223. where:
  224.    filespec is the starting location and definition of
  225.             the search files.
  226.    string   is the string to search for and must be
  227.             enclosed in quotes.
  228.    /c       look in children directories as well as
  229.             starting location when search for strings.
  230.    /i       case insensitive search for string.
  231.    /t       display line of text in which string
  232.             located.
  233.    >output  location to save output file if not sent
  234.             to screen.
  235.  
  236. C>locate c:\*.DOC
  237.     find all .DOC files on C drive.
  238. C>locate c:\*.DOC "funny"
  239.     find all .DOC files in root directory of C which
  240.     contain the string funny.
  241. C>locate c:\*.DOC "funny" /C
  242.     like above except all .DOC files on disk C
  243. C>locate "funny" /i /t >save
  244.     find all the files on default directory which
  245.     contain the string(s) funny, FUNNY, Funny, ..., and
  246.     save this information in the file SAVE on the
  247.     default directory.  Also display the lines of text
  248.     in which the strings were located.
  249. P90.EXE
  250. -------
  251. Print files at 90 degrees.
  252. Requires full IBM PC compatability and an Epson
  253. compatible printer.  If not fully compatible with IBM
  254. PC, may run using parameters.
  255.  
  256. To start:
  257. C>p90            then answer menu questions.
  258.  
  259. To run with parameters:
  260. C>p90 f=fs w=# d=h s=n t=# n=# l=# m=# p=1 q=y b=n
  261.  
  262. where:
  263.    f= filespec of the file to print.
  264.    w= 8,9, .. 16 sheet width in inches
  265.    d= h or v  direction (horizontal 90 deg) (vert)
  266.    s= c or n  print density (compressed)  (normal)
  267.    t= #       number of blank lines at top of page
  268.    n= #       spaces for left margin
  269.    l= #       max lines per page
  270.    m= #       max line length
  271.    p= #       number of formfeeds after each page
  272.    q= y or n  print formfeed at end of file (yes no)
  273.    b= y or n  double strike each line (yes no)
  274.  
  275. (Parameters intended for .BAT files).
  276.  
  277.  
  278.  
  279. PC_SORT.EXE
  280. -----------
  281. Sort files with up to 4 fields where each field may be
  282. ascending or descending, case sensitive or case
  283. insensitive.
  284.  
  285. To start:
  286. C>pc_sort
  287.  
  288. Answer menu of questions.  To run with parameters,
  289. especially from .BAT files:
  290.  
  291. C>pc_sort  <input >output
  292. sorts file INPUT as ascending, case sensitive, for the
  293. enter length of each line, and saves the results in file
  294. OUTPUT.
  295.  
  296. C>pc_sort <input >output /d/s/C#/L# /FdsC#L# .. /FdsC#L#
  297. Like above except field 1 defined as /d/sC#/L# and
  298. fields 2, 3 and 4 defined as /FdsC#L#
  299. where:
  300.     d = A or D for ascending or descending.
  301.     s = I or S for case insensitive or case sensitive.
  302.     #   is a number.
  303.    C# = beginning column number for field.
  304.    L# = length of field.
  305.  
  306.    /F   indicates beginning the definition of a new
  307.         field.
  308. PRN_FILE.EXE
  309. ------------
  310. Redirects all information normally sent to your printer
  311. to a disk file.
  312.  
  313. To start:
  314. C>prn_file
  315.  
  316. You will be asked for program to run and where to save
  317. printer output.
  318.  
  319. You may specify the program to run and its parameters as
  320. parameters:
  321. C>prn_file pclabel a:dflt.lbl
  322.  
  323. in which case you would not be asked for the program to
  324. run from within PRN_FILE.
  325.  
  326.  
  327.  
  328. RDIR.EXE
  329. --------
  330. Remove subdirectory including all files and all children
  331. directories.
  332.  
  333. C>rdir
  334. will present a screen of instructions.
  335.  
  336. To start:
  337. C>rdir pathspec
  338.  
  339. The directory named in pathspec will be removed after
  340. user confirmation.  If no disk is given, default drive
  341. assumed.
  342.  
  343.  
  344.  
  345. SET_SCRN.EXE
  346. ------------
  347. Set screen border color and default screen colors.
  348. Requires the line DEVICE=ANSI.SYS in CONFIG.SYS
  349. file and full IBM PC compatability.  No parameters.
  350.  
  351. To start:
  352. C>set_scrn
  353.  
  354. Select the colors you want and then exit the program.
  355. Creates the file SETSCRN.COM which you may then use in
  356. your AUTOEXEC.BAT file and to reset screen colors.  Does
  357. not work with Borland's Lightning.
  358. SNAPSHOT.COM
  359. ------------
  360. Take pictures of any 80 column screen (not graphics) in
  361. any program.  May be installed as resident program, but
  362. not necessary.  Requires full IBM PC compatability.
  363.  
  364. To start:
  365. C>snapshot s=res c=n f=filespec b=on
  366.  
  367. where:
  368.    s=res causes program to becom resident.
  369.    c=n   provides background color for review
  370.          screen.  (n=1,2..6)
  371.    f=filespec name and location of where snapshots
  372.          should be stored.  There must be no file
  373.          extension.  E.g. c:\subdir\snap
  374.    b=on  for PC-TYPE owners, this option will
  375.          distinguish between high and low intensity
  376.          and turn bold printing on or off
  377.          accordingly.
  378.  
  379. Minimum parameters to run:
  380.  
  381. C>snapshot
  382.  
  383. Will not be resident, hence you will be asked to enter
  384. the program of which you want to take snapshots.  Review
  385. screen will be black and white.  Snapshots will be saved
  386. in files SNAPSHOT.NN on default directory where NN will
  387. be 01, 02, .... 99.   No PC-TYPE bolding.
  388.  
  389. To take a snapshot, press Alt Ctrl P.   To review
  390. snapshots, press Alt Ctrl R.
  391.  
  392.  
  393.  
  394. SWCOM12.COM
  395. -----------
  396. Switch RS-232 ports for COM1 and COM2.  No parameters.
  397.  
  398. To start:
  399. C>swcom12
  400.  
  401.  
  402. SWLPT12.COM
  403. -----------
  404. Switch printer ports for LPT1 and LPT2.  No parameters.
  405.  
  406. To start:
  407. C>swlpt12
  408.